Alphageo (India) Limited reported a net loss per share of ₹-9.6 for the second quarter of fiscal 2025, with no analyst estimate available for comparison. Revenue stood at ₹1,256.75 million, reflecting a 27.37% year-on-year increase. The stock declined 2.1% on the NSE following the announcement, indicating market disappointment with the continued loss.

The 27% revenue growth was driven by higher contract execution in the seismic survey and oilfield services segment, benefiting from increased exploration activity in domestic basins. However, the company reported a net loss, suggesting that operational costs—particularly raw materials, employee expenses, and subcontractor charges—rose faster than revenue. Gross margins may have been compressed due to competitive pricing in bidding for government and private sector contracts. Alphageo’s balance sheet remains leveraged, with finance costs likely weighing on profitability. The Q2 performance reflects the lumpy nature of the geophysical services business, where revenue recognition depends on project milestones and seasonal factors. Despite the top-line expansion, the inability to convert revenue into profit raises concerns about cost control and project execution efficiency. Management has not issued formal guidance for the remainder of the fiscal year, but the company continues to focus on winning contracts from oil and gas exploration companies, including ONGC and private players. Geographic diversification into newer sedimentary basins may support future revenue growth. Cost optimization initiatives, such as rationalizing subcontractor expenses and improving equipment utilization, are expected to be pursued. However, risks include volatile crude oil prices, regulatory delays, and high competitive intensity in the domestic seismic services market. The company may also face working capital pressure if project payment cycles lengthen. Any improvement in margins will depend on securing higher-margin contracts and achieving better operational leverage in the coming quarters. The 2.1% decline in Alphageo’s stock on the NSE suggests that investors focused on the net loss rather than the revenue growth. Given the absence of consensus estimates, the earnings surprise cannot be assessed, but the loss likely fell short of market expectations. Analysts may adopt a cautious stance until the company demonstrates sustainable profitability. Key metrics to watch in subsequent quarters include gross margin trend, order book size, and debt levels. The next quarterly result will be closely monitored for signs of margin recovery and any management commentary on future demand. The broader oil and gas exploration cycle remains supportive, but Alphageo must prove its ability to convert revenue into earnings before investor sentiment improves.
